Description:
Fittinig of a linear light source The subject of the invention is a fitting of a linear light source designed in particular to build light lines to mark the traffic arteries, evacuation ways and contours of walls, stairs and the other architectural elements.

In the patent description of the P-341173 PL invention a design of the fitting of linear light source line has been presented. The fitting, according to the design, consists basically of two longitudinal shape mounting elements- of a seat and closing covers, which are separable joined with each other, having a space inside of which a linear light source is located. The closing cover is made of a light transmitting material.

The aim of the invention is to develop a fitting of a linear light source which enables to compose long light lines of possibly simple structure and easy mounting, A fitting of a linear light source makes up a longitudinal shape profile which includes at least one longitudinal seat for a linear light source, which has a form of a flexible conduit made of light transmitting material, containing several light emitting diodes (LED) along its whole length.

The essence of the fitting design according to the invention consists on it that the longitudinal profile seat) is open and has a shape of a transverse cross section corresponding to a shape of the transverse cross section of the conduit mounted in it, and the conduit pressed into the seat and the profile has at least one longitudinal arm to fasten the fitting directly or indirectly to its base.

The profile seat has a square shape in its transverse cross section and its side walls have longitudinal grooves.

-A longitudinal flat arm comes out at one side of the profile seat to fasten the fitting to its base and the seat is so inclined against the arm surface that its side wall which is at the other side of the arm is located below its outside surface. Inside the arm there is at least one longitudinal recess.

A longitudinal cover protrudes in an archway under the seat below the side wall of the seat located on the other side of the arm.

A longitudinal rib protrudes from the internal side of the cover, located parallel to the arm plane.

At the end of the profile there is a separably set stopper which closes the fitting.

The stopper ties the profile from outside however its side wall which covers the side of the profile has a shape of the profile cross-section.

The stopper is set on the profile with a longitudinal bend of its bottom part fastened on profile cover and with a pin coming out from inside of the side wall and entering the recess of the profile arm.

In the profitable version of the fitting the longitudinal arms come out symmetrically from the seat at its both sides which are connected with their mounting part of a close to U shape under the seat.

The profile seat has a partly open bottom, and a longitudinal slot makes its opening The profile arms are inclined from the seat towards the base.

The fitting according to the invention is characteristic of its simple structure of small number of component parts and thus of simple assembly.

The fitting of a linear light source according to the invention in its exemplary execution presented in fig. 1,3 and 4 is designed to light up the outline of stair steps. It consists of a longitudinal shape aluminum profile 1, linear light source which has a form of a flexible conduit 2 made of a light transmitting material, containing on its whole length several light emitting diodes (LEDs) and one or two stoppers 3 mounted on one or two ends of a profile 1. Profile 1 contains a longitudinal seal 4 with a conduit 2 pressed into it, whereas the seat 4 runs along the whole length of the profile 1. The longitudinal seat 4 of the profile 1 is open and has a shape of transverse cross-section corresponding to the shape of cross-section of the pressed in conduit 2 of square cross-section, and the side walls 5 of the seat 4 have longitudinal grooves 6. During pressing the conduit 2 into the seat 4 the flexible material of the conduit 2 enters the grooves 6 setting the conduit 2 securely in the seat 4. The conduit 2 after its setting fills out the seat 4 completely. Profile 1 has one longitudinal flat arm 7 running along its whole length, coming out at one side of the seat 4 and designed to fasten the fitting with screws to the base, which is a stair step in this example. The seat 4 is so inclined against the surface of arm 7 that its side wall 5 which is at the other side of the arm 7 is located below its outside surface. Inclination of the seat 4 is chosen to provide the same or nearly the same visibility of the light line for persons going up or down the stairs. The arm 7 has a longitudinal recess 8. at inside At the side wall 5 of the seat 4 located at the other side of the arm 7 a longitudinal cover 9 comes out arch wise under the seat 4, which runs along the whole length of the profile 1, whereas a longitudinal rib 10 of the same length comes out from its outside part, located in parallel to arm 7. The arch wise shape of the cover 9 running towards the vertical part of the stair step eliminates the possibility of stumbling on the fitting while going up the stairs and the rib 10 is a support of the cover 9 against the vertical part of the stair step. At the end of the profile 1 there is a separable stopper 3 which closes the fitting and protects connectors the feeding cables connectors of the conduit 2. The stopper 3 ties outside the end of the profile 1 and its side wall 11, which covers profile 1 side, has a shape of profile 1 cross-section outline.

The stopper 3 on the profile 1 is set with a longitudinal bend of its bottom part j ! 2 fastened on cover 9 of the profile 1 and with a pin 13 coming out of external side of its side wall 11 which enters the recess 8 of the arm 7 of the profile 1. The pin 13 has a shape of a half cylinder which corresponds with the shape of the cross-section of the longitudinal recess 8 of the arm 7. After mounting the fitting on a stair step, the pin 13 located in recess 8 is immobilized with the arm 7 tightened to the stair step.

In the other exemplary execution the fitting of the linear light source, presented in fig. 2 is designed to mark object outlines, evacuation ways or traffic arteries in which it is mounted on walls or ceilings. In such design of the fitting, in its profile 14 at both sides come out from the seat 4 symmetrically longitudinal arms 15 which are connected under seat 4 with the mounting part 16 of a shape close to a letter U. The seat 4 of the profile 14 has a partly open bottom and the opening is a longitudinal slot 17 running through the whole length of the profile 14. And the arms 15 of the profile 14 from the seat 4 are inclined towards the base.

In profile 14 between the arms 15 the seat 4 and the mounting part 16 there is a closed space designed for location of cables which feed the conduit 2. And the slot 17 of the seat 4 enables fastening the fitting to the base through which it is possible to fasten with screws the mounting part 16 to the base.
